Building at Kardinal-Faulhaber-Strasse 10 in Munich

The building at Kardinal-Faulhaber-Strasse 10 is a bank building in Munich . It was built in 1895/96 according to a design by the Munich architect Albert Schmidt for the Bayerische Hypotheken- und Wechsel-Bank and is registered as a monument in the Bavarian list of monuments under the number D-1-62-000-3234 .
